Intermediate Administrative Certificate Admission Requirements

Students applying to the Graduate Program must hold a bachelor's degree from an accredited institution.   

For matriculation in any of the Graduate Education Programs students must submit:

  • Graduate application form and a non-refundable application fee.
  • Two letters of recommendation.
  • Official transcript(s) from all colleges and universities previously attended.
  • Current resume.
  • Case Study Responce (Case Study will be mailed to you once we receive your application)

Candidate for the Intermediate Administrative Certificate Program must also

  • Hold or be eligible for a Connecticut teaching certificate.
  • Hold a master's degree from an approved institution.
  • Completed five years teaching experience (if the applicant lacks this prerequisite, a student may partially fulfill this requirement through a practicum included in the planned program of preparation)
  • Completed a course in special education (at least 36 hours)

Applications for the weekend-based cohort program are due by March 1 for classes beginning in the Fall term.  Applications for the traditional evening program are accepted on a rolling basis throughout the year, but you should allow yourself plenty of time to complete the application requiresments, so don't delay.
